and the post office management had no interest in proving otherwise
they should be going after the management
In this case it should have been very easy to provide evidence to override the presumption that the Horizon system was working correctly. That this didn’t happen seems to have resulted from a combination of bad lawyering and shameless mendacity on the part of Fujitsu and the Post Office.
Don’t get me wrong — the whole thing is a giant scandal. I’m just not sure if this particular presumption of UK law is the appropriate scapegoat.
Defense had to prove that only one Horizon/Fujitsu accounting software was buggy and the whole prosecution falls apart e.g. If John's Horizon/Fujitsu accounting software has bugs then Peter's Horizon/Fujitsu accounting software most probably has bugs too.
One case where defense did get access to the code (FST developed by NYC) led to discoveries (https://www.propublica.org/article/federal-judge-unseals-new...) that led to it being retired from use.
I’d argue that some kind of weak presumption along these lines clearly makes sense and is probably universal across legal systems. For example, suppose the police find that X has an incriminating email from Y after searching X’s laptop. Are they required to prove that GMail doesn’t have a bug causing it to corrupt email contents or send emails to the wrong recipients? Presumably not.